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
---|---|
10th Percentile Wage | $69,220 |
25th Percentile Wage | $85,980 |
50th Percentile Wage | $95,550 |
75th Percentile Wage | $105,310 |
90th Percentile Wage | $123,610 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salaries for computer programmers in the industry of cable and other subscription programming. The salaries are shown in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) computer programmers is $123,610. The median annual salary (50th percentile) is $95,550.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ent computer programmers is $69,220.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of computer programmers in the industry of Cable and Other Subscription Programming from 2012 to 2017.
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 5-Year Growth |
---|---|---|---|
2017 | $95,550 | 6.93% | 15.91% |
2016 | $88,930 | 1.62% | - |
2015 | $87,490 | 1.36% | - |
2014 | $86,300 | -0.83% | - |
2013 | $87,020 | 7.66% | - |
2012 | $80,350 | - | - |
